Yearly Statement Filing Requirements in the State of Florida


Within Florida, annual report submission represents a critical aspect of maintaining good standing for your business entity. All corporation, LLC, and various business entities registered within the state must file an annual report to provide updated details regarding the business. This requirement aids ensure that the state has accurate and current records for each incorporated entity. The report is generally due on May 1 of each year, and timely filings are crucial to avoid fines, including possible official dissolution.


The annual report contains multiple information such as the business's location, the names and locations of the company's officers, and information about the designated agent. Having a dependable designated agent in Florida is imperative, as they will receive official papers and make sure you are reminded of forthcoming due dates. Failure to keep a up-to-date registered agent can complicate the annual filing process and could lead to adverse outcomes for your entity.


To submit the yearly statement, businesses can do so via the internet through the official Florida business registrar website. The process is simple, but it is crucial to finish the submission promptly, as late filings incur additional fees. By ensuring that your registered agent is informed and up to date with your entity's current status, you can streamline the yearly report filing process and ensure adherence with Florida business regulations.

How to Change Your Agent of Record in the State of Florida


Changing your registered agent in the State of Florida is a straightforward process that can be carried out in a couple of stages. First, you need to pick a different agent of record who fulfills the Florida requirements. This individual or company must be a resident of Florida or a corporation authorized to do business in the state. Once you have chosen your replacement agent, ensure you have their consent to serve in this role.


The following step includes completing and submitting the appropriate documentation with the Florida Department of State. You will need to file an designated document called the Register Agent Change Form along with the required fees. It is important to provide precise details about both the existing and replacement registered agents to avoid any delays in processing the update. Make sure to check the latest criteria and fees on the Florida Department of State's official site.
